Diarrhea: My yorkypoo has diarrhea for about 3 days. We give him some Imodium and it did not help and we gave some rice and broth no help. |
Persistent diarrhea that lasts more than 24 hrs usually requires a vet visit. Is it diarrhea or soft stools? You need to make sure your little one is not dehydrated if it is diarrhea. Have you recently switched his diet? Any other changes? Does he act normal otherwise or does he seem sick? Did your vet recommend immodium? Oscar's Mummy: He drinks his water and no we did not switch his food he eats chicken breast and veggys with some test of the wild hard dog food. |
I am so sorry your baby is sick. I recommend you take him to a vet. He could possibly have coccidia or giardia or a stomach bacterial infection and he would need to be treated by a vet. In the mean time you can give him a teaspoon of pure canned pumpkin twice a day for the diarrhea. I hope your baby gets well soon. |
